JOB SUMMARY: A Machine Operator 2 is responsible for operating multiple machines. Candidates
must be willing and able to work in a fast-paced manufacturing environment. Must be able to communicate and work effectively in a team environment. Must be able to follow instructions (written & verbal), safely and accurately operate bakery equipment and maintain GMP standards. 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ES: * Mixer (batter, dough, icing & cream) * Depositor * Oven * Fryer * Tumbler * Injector * Wrapper * Combi * Other duties as defined. *Equipment may vary by facility. JOB SPECIFICATIONS AND REQUIREMENTS: E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E: Requires high school diploma, or equivalent. Prefer previous safety training. WORKING CONDITIONS: Manufacturing Environment P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S: Although the physical requirements vary each day, the employee must have the ability to sit (5%), stand (40%), walk (10%), kneel/squat (20%) and bend (25%) for 12 hours. Ability to lift approximately up to a maximum of 50 pounds, approximately 4 times per day from floor to waist. Ability to reach from 10 inches approximately 2 hours per day, and up to 60 inches approximately 1 hour per day. Ability to climb stairs approximately 8 times per day, ladders approximately 1-2 times per day, and crawling approximately 3 to 4 times per week. Performs repetitive motion, using the hands and arms approximately 1 hour per day and the back (twisting) approximately 1 hour per day. Must be able to perform pushing/pulling of the upper body approximately 5 to 6 times per day and the whole body approximately 4 to 5 times per day. May push and pull trash carts weighing 500 lb, dough carts weighing 800 lb, portable equipment and catch pans weighing 500 lb. May walk on unprotected heights, catwalks, etc. occasionally every week. Cannot be afraid of heights. Must be in good physical condition. OTHER ESSENTIAL ELEMENTS NOT LISTED ABOVE INCLUDE: Organizational skills, read and follow formulations, calculating batter time and length, ability to record batter and exceptions, compute exceptions, ability to watch two machines and know what stage of mixing each is in, ability to make batter adjustments, add weight together (ounces & pounds). Ability to identify ingredients in and out of packing containers, hearing, understanding instructions and seeing. MACHINES/TOOLS USED: Scrapers, box knife, bowl knife, scoops, bucket, thermometer, measuring cup, hair net, hearing protection, safety glasses and bump caps.
